SAVE THE RED CHURCH (Kizil Kilise) !
A lonely proud church stands since the 6th century opposite the chain of Melendiz mountains. It’s the only remaining built church of that period in Cappadocia. Kizil Kilise is thought to have been built on a property belonging to St Gregory of Naziance, one of the founders of Christianity in Cappadocia and his tomb may have been in the church.
If nothing is done soon, the church’s dome will fall and the rest of the church will collapse with it.
SAVE MERYEMANA !
Teh Meryeman church is in a huge cone in the Kilçilar valley, close to the Tokali church in Göreme museum. The church is architecturally splendid and is covered with paintings from the 10th century with scenes of Virgin Mary’s life. The church has been closed since 1976 because the cliff it’s in may collapse.
The Association «Friends of Cappadocia” is trying to save the church by stopping the erosion at the foot of the cone and by reinforcing the base of the cone that is threatening to collapse. The monument could be saved without spending a huge amount.
